Understanding the Basics
Ratchet straps are also known as tie-down straps, cargo straps, or lashing straps. They are made of a webbing material that is strong and durable. The straps come in various lengths and widths and are designed to secure cargo or equipment to a trailer, truck, or other vehicles.
The importance of using ratchet straps cannot be overstated. When used correctly, ratchet straps can prevent shifting, bouncing, or falling of the cargo. This can reduce the risk of accidents on the road and ensure safe transportation. The benefits of using ratchet straps include reduced liability, protection of the cargo, and compliance with safety regulations.

3. How do I use a ratchet strap?
To use a ratchet strap, place the anchor point on the cargo or equipment and attach the hook to the anchor point. Pull the webbing through the ratchet and tighten it by pumping the handle up and down. Once the cargo is secure, lock the ratchet in place.
4. How tight should I make the ratchet strap?
You should tighten the ratchet strap until the cargo is secure and does not move or shift during transportation. However, you should not over-tighten the strap as this can damage the cargo or equipment.
5. Can I reuse ratchet straps?
Yes, you can reuse ratchet straps as long as they are in good condition and meet safety standards. However, you should inspect them before each use and replace any damaged or worn-out parts.
6. What safety precautions should I take when using ratchet straps?
You should always follow safety guidelines and regulations when using ratchet straps. This includes inspecting the equipment before each use, securing the cargo properly, and never over-tightening the straps. You should also wear protective gear such as gloves and safety glasses.
7. How do I store ratchet straps?
You should store ratchet straps in a clean and dry place away from direct sunlight and heat. You should also ensure that they are coiled properly and not tangled. Storing them properly will help prolong their lifespan and ensure that they are ready for use when needed.
